**Q: Why do my plugin's humidity readings slowly diverge from the GrowMesh baseline?**

Sensor drift. The Verdantix T-40 probes lose calibration after roughly 900 hours of continuous operation, and the greenhouse controller does not auto-correct for third-party plugins. Do not compensate in plugin code; apply the controller's drift offset API instead, or your values will double-correct after recalibration cycles. Recalibration schedules vary per site. Full drift tables and the offset API reference are on the internal wiki page here:

operations page: https://confluence.tolvaqsys.corp/spaces/pages/pages/6e787158f507

Q: Why does DNS resolution flake on the Quillbarrow workers?
A: Short version: the sidecar resolver caches NXDOMAIN for way too long, so a single hiccup from the upstream at our Dunmore site poisons lookups for five minutes. We shortened the negative TTL and added a retry with jitter. If it recurs, restart the resolver pod, not the app. Vault access for the resolver config needs the recovery passphrase below.

vault phrase of fawif-haduf = wenwyn-briath

Heads-up: this alert fires when requests hit the legacy user module inside the Marrowstack monolith instead of the new Fennel user service. We're mid-split, so some traffic bleeding through is expected, but a sustained spike means the routing shim regressed. Check recent deploys first — it's almost always the shim config. The migration plan and current cutover percentages are tracked on the internal page here.

wiki page, tahaf-tajog: https://jira.ordindyn.corp/pipeline

Minutes — Capacity Decision, Vellmore Works
Attendees: Harte, Quill, Osman. Chair: Harte.
Decision deferred on adding a third press line at the Dunmarsh site. Utilisation at 87%; overtime unsustainable past Q3. Quill to cost a two-shift extension; Osman to verify supplier lead times. Incoming director to arbitrate by month end. Budget ceiling unchanged. The confidential note below summarises the plan under consideration.

board note of tawig-bajof: The renewal with Ralixix Holdings closes at $10 million a year, 20 percent above the last contract. Project Druix slips by two quarters because of the tooling delay.